The 711 Speakout is great. The basic phone is $60. It comes pre-activated with a phone# and some airtime. No need to call in or register (no name, credit card or ID required). The $25 airtime card is good for 1-year (most expire in 3-months). Per minute rate is 25 cents (if you buy the $75 airtime voucher, your rate drops to 20 cents/minute). The only monthly fee is a 99 cent 911 fee that is deducted from the pre-paid balance. It comes with Caller ID and voice mail. . It operates on the Rogers network, so I find coverage is good.
If someone refers you, you (and the person that referred you) gets a $10 airtime credit.
